What You’ll Do:
As a Merchandiser, your main goal is to make our products shine in stores. Your responsibilities include:
- Merchandising Execution: Visit assigned retail stores to set up and maintain product displays according to company guidelines.
- Product Presentation: Arrange eye-catching displays that attract customers and boost sales.
- Stock Management: Monitor inventory, conduct regular checks, and coordinate with store managers to ensure shelves are always stocked.
- Planogram Compliance: Follow visual guides (planograms) to ensure products are in the correct positions for maximum impact.
- Sales Optimization: Track trends, identify opportunities, and suggest improvements to increase sales.
- Promotional Support: Set up promotions, signage, and pricing in collaboration with store staff and marketing teams.
- Data Reporting: Collect and report sales figures, stock levels, and market insights to inform merchandising strategies.
- Team Training: Provide guidance to store staff on product knowledge and merchandising best practices.

Working Conditions in Retail and FMCG Sectors:
Working conditions in retail and FMCG sectors in the UK can be dynamic and fast-paced. Merchandisers often work on store floors, arranging displays, tracking stock, and ensuring products are presented according to brand standards. Typical hours range from 37 to 40 hours per week, with occasional evenings, weekends, or holiday shifts. Many employers provide uniforms, training, and clear health and safety protocols to maintain a supportive work environment.
Career Growth Opportunities for Merchandisers:
A career as a merchandiser offers strong career growth opportunities. Entry-level positions can progress to senior merchandising roles, category management, or retail operations. With experience, merchandisers can move into brand management, supply chain coordination, or regional supervisory roles. Professional development courses and certifications in retail management or marketing further enhance advancement prospects.
